Artist and illustrator J.C. Leyendecker (1874-1951) helped shape modern American visual culture as the mind behind advertising campaigns like the legendary “Arrow Collar Man.” He was also responsible for countless covers for the Saturday Evening Post—one more, in fact, than Norman Rockwell. Modern biographers also hold that Leyendecker was a gay man. Critics are now asking themselves whether his sexuality permeated into some of his most iconic commercial illustrations. You will hear about a fascinating artist – J. C. Leyendecker- who's illustrations epitomized the lifestyles of America in the early 20th century. Note: this will be a PG rated episode. His commercial art – primarily in magazines, became an iconic art style from the 1900's through the 1930's. You may not have heard the name of Leyendecker – but you can learn about his fascinating career both at an upcoming show of his works (New York Historical Society, May 5th - Aug. 13th, link) and through this podcast episode. He was also a major influence for Norman Rockwell, one of America's most beloved 20th century artists. You will learn of the evolution of Leyendecker's style – from the Paris art scene of the 1900's to then reflecting the elegant lifestyle of the 1920's that men and women strived for. Dennis shares his experiences creating event posters. ... A native San Franciscan, Dennis graduated with a Bachelor of Fine Arts degree from the California College of the Arts. His knack for composition paired with his eye for color gave him a distinctive look and he was able to establish himself as an illustrator in San Francisco. Wanting to explore more opportunities as an illustrator, he moved to New York in 1980. While there, he flourished as an artist, which eventually led him to a successful career as one of the nation's top illustrators. His compelling poster images include the NFL Super Bowl XXIX and the 2006 Kentucky Derby. His paintings were featured on many well-known book covers including, the Tales of the City series by Armisted Maupin, and several covers for authors Elmore Leonard and James Lee Burke. Dennis was the featured cover artist for Hemispheres, United Airlines in-flight magazine, the National Lampoon and, more recently, Western Art Collector, American Art Collector, Southwest Art, and the Jackson Hole Traveler. Dennis' strong and richly colored images borrow much of their inspiration from early 20th century paintings and posters. His early influences, J.C. Leyendecker, N.C. Wyeth, Ludwig Hohlwein and Tom Purvis, were all master designers in composition. The demands of illustration and poster design, with its simplified, sculpturally rendered images gave Dennis the discipline and draftsmanship that gives strength to his paintings today. Dennis is not only an artist, but has taught at the California College of the Arts, the Academy of Art in San Francisco, as well as Syracuse University in New York. In 1986 he returned to his roots in California, bought property, and settled in the Sonoma wine country. About this time, Dennis turned his attention to fine art, when continuous requests of his original images were made and private paintings were commissioned. For the last 30 years, Dennis has been painting in oils for his galleries and private clients. Dennis' work is in the permanent collections of the Tucson Museum of Art, Bakersfield Museum of Art, the Booth Western Art Museum, Western Spirit: Scottsdale's Museum of the West, and the Whitney Western Art Museum at the Buffalo Bill Center of the West. Der Investigativjournalist Hans Leyendecker berichtete 1993 von einer vermeintlichen »Exekution« des RAF-Mitglieds Wolfgang Grams durch die Polizei während des Einsatzes in Bad Kleinen. Damals berief er sich auf einen anonymen Beamten, der am Tatort gewesen sei. Im Nachhinein stellte sich dies als falsch heraus. Zum ersten Mal hat Leyendecker in einem Interview über die Details der Recherche, die eine Staatsaffäre auslöste, geredet. Das Gespräch, das Holger Stark und Heinrich Wefing geführt haben, wurde vergangene Woche als »Bestes Interview« mit dem Reporterpreis ausgezeichnet. In dieser Folge berichtet Holger Stark, wie das preisgekrönte Gespräch zustande gekommen ist.
